Mg B
Based on 32,932 Mg B vehicles and 193,391 completed MOT tests, the Mg B has an overall 78% pass rate, with an average recorded mileage of 52,356 miles.

Most common Mg B MOT faults
These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Mg B MOT tests:
- Oil leak (5,255 times)
- Parking brake: efficiency below requirements (3.7.B.7) (3,743 times)
- Wind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id (8.2.3) (3,275 times)
- Exhaust emissions carbon monoxide content excessive (7.3.B.1a) (3,169 times)
- Oil leak, but not excessive (8.4.1 (a) (i)) (2,898 times)
- Horn not working (1.6.2a) (2,740 times)
- Nearside Front wheel bearing has slight play (2.5.A.3c) (2,556 times)
- Offside Front wheel bearing has slight play (2.5.A.3c) (2,295 times)
- Nearside Front Axle king pin has slight play in pin and/or bush (2.5.A.3a) (2,259 times)
- Offside Front Axle king pin has slight play in pin and/or bush (2.5.A.3a) (2,146 times)
- Nearside Rear Shock absorber has a light misting of oil (2.7.3) (1,700 times)
- Exhaust emissions hydrocarbon content excessive (7.3.B.1b) (1,583 times)
- Brakes imbalanced across an axle (3.7.B.5b) (1,523 times)
- Offside Rear Shock absorber has a light misting of oil (2.7.3) (1,511 times)
- Nearside Front Shock absorber has a light misting of oil (2.7.3) (1,500 times)
